3. Measure Your home

There's nothing worse than love a piece of furniture simply to realize it won't easily fit in your space. Before maneuvering to the furniture store, measure the dimensions of the room or area where you plan to place the furniture. Pay attention to any obstacles such as doors, windows, or architectural features which could affect placement.

5. Test Before buying

When shopping for furniture, it's important to test out pieces before you make a purchase. Take a seat on sofas and chairs to gauge comfort, open and shut drawers to test for smooth operation, and inspect the development and materials for quality and sturdiness. Don't be afraid to question questions or request fabric swatches or wood samples that will help you make an educated decision.
